Understanding Crab Anatomy
Before we dive into specific species, let's get familiar with the basic crab anatomy. Understanding the different body parts will make crab identification much easier. Think of it as learning the alphabet before reading a book – it's fundamental! Crabs belong to the infraorder Brachyura, which means "short tail" in Greek. This refers to their abdomen, which is tucked tightly under their carapace, the hard upper shell. This unique feature is one of the key characteristics that sets crabs apart from other crustaceans, such as lobsters or shrimp, whose tails are long and prominent. The carapace serves as a protective shield, safeguarding the crab's vital organs from predators and the harsh elements of their environment. It's like their own personal suit of armor! The shape of the carapace can vary widely depending on the species, ranging from round and oval to square and even heart-shaped. This variation in shape is one of the first clues you can use to recognize a crab and narrow down its identity. The surface of the carapace can also provide valuable clues. Some crabs have smooth, glossy shells, while others have bumpy, textured surfaces covered in spines or tubercles. These surface features can help the crab camouflage itself in its natural habitat, blending seamlessly with rocks, sand, or seaweed. Beyond the carapace, crabs have ten legs, arranged in five pairs. The first pair of legs are modified into claws, called chelipeds, which are used for a variety of tasks, including feeding, defense, and attracting mates. The size and shape of the chelipeds can vary greatly between species, and even between males and females of the same species. In some species, the claws are symmetrical, while in others, one claw is significantly larger than the other. This asymmetry can be a useful characteristic for crab species identification. The remaining four pairs of legs are used for walking and swimming. Most crabs are known for their sideways gait, a characteristic movement that is a direct result of the way their legs are jointed. However, some crabs can also walk forward or backward, and some are even capable of swimming. The legs of aquatic crabs are often flattened and paddle-like, which helps them move efficiently through the water. Terrestrial crabs, on the other hand, tend to have sturdier legs that are better suited for walking on land. 1. Carapace Shape and Size
The crab carapace is like its calling card. It's the first thing you'll notice, and it can tell you a lot about the crab. The shape can be round, oval, square, heart-shaped, or even triangular. Size matters too! Some crabs are tiny, barely bigger than a fingernail, while others can be as big as a dinner plate. For example, the Dungeness crab, a popular delicacy on the West Coast of North America, has a broad, oval carapace that can grow up to 10 inches wide. On the other hand, the pea crab, a tiny commensal crab that lives inside the shells of other marine animals, has a carapace that is only a few millimeters across. So, the size difference is quite significant! The shape of the carapace is influenced by a variety of factors, including the crab's lifestyle, habitat, and evolutionary history. Crabs that live in tight spaces, such as crevices and burrows, often have flattened carapaces that allow them to squeeze into narrow openings. Crabs that are active swimmers may have more streamlined carapaces that reduce drag in the water. The texture and ornamentation of the carapace can also be important clues. Some crabs have smooth, glossy carapaces, while others have rough, bumpy surfaces. Some crabs have spines, tubercles, or ridges on their carapaces, which can provide protection from predators or help them blend in with their surroundings. For instance, the decorator crab is known for its habit of attaching pieces of seaweed, shells, and other debris to its carapace, creating a camouflage suit that helps it disappear against the seafloor. The color of the carapace is another important characteristic. Crabs come in a wide range of colors, from drab browns and grays to vibrant reds, oranges, and blues. The color of the carapace can help the crab blend in with its habitat, or it can serve as a warning signal to potential predators. Some crabs can even change their color to match their surroundings, a remarkable adaptation that allows them to become virtually invisible. 2. Claw Shape and Size
The crab claws, or chelipeds, are like the crab's multi-tool. They use them for everything from catching food to defending themselves. The size and shape of the claws can be a major giveaway when it comes to identifying a crab species. Some crabs have massive, powerful claws, while others have delicate, slender ones. The fiddler crab, for example, is famous for its asymmetrical claws, with the male having one enormous claw that can be almost half the size of its body. This oversized claw is used for attracting mates and fighting off rivals, and it's a classic example of sexual dimorphism, where males and females of the same species have different physical characteristics. Other crabs, such as the blue crab, have claws that are more symmetrical and equally sized. These claws are adapted for crushing and tearing prey, and they are equipped with sharp teeth that can make short work of shellfish and other invertebrates. The shape of the claws can also vary widely. Some crabs have claws that are long and slender, perfect for picking up small pieces of food or probing into crevices. Others have claws that are broad and flattened, ideal for digging in the sand or mud. The texture of the claws can also be informative. Some crabs have claws that are smooth and polished, while others have claws that are covered in bumps, ridges, or spines. These surface features can help the crab grip its prey or provide additional protection against predators. The color of the claws can also be a helpful clue. Some crabs have claws that are the same color as their carapace, while others have claws that are brightly colored or patterned. 3. Leg Structure
The crab legs are another important feature to consider. Crabs have ten legs in total: two claws (chelipeds) and eight walking legs. The walking legs can vary in shape and size depending on the species, and these variations can be helpful for identification. Most crabs are known for their sideways walk, which is a direct result of the way their legs are jointed. However, some crabs can also walk forward or backward, and some are even capable of swimming. For example, the swimming crab has flattened, paddle-like legs that are adapted for swimming. These legs allow the crab to move quickly and efficiently through the water, making it a formidable predator. Other crabs, such as the ghost crab, have long, slender legs that are adapted for running on the sand. These legs allow the crab to move quickly across the beach, making it difficult to catch. The shape and size of the leg segments can also be informative. Some crabs have legs that are long and spindly, while others have legs that are short and stout. Some crabs have legs that are covered in spines or bristles, which can provide additional traction or protection. The arrangement of the legs can also be helpful for identification. Some crabs have legs that are closely spaced together, while others have legs that are widely spread apart. 4. Habitat and Behavior
Where you find a crab and how it behaves can also be a big clue to its identity. Some crabs prefer sandy beaches, while others live in rocky intertidal zones or even deep ocean trenches. Their behavior, such as how they move, feed, and interact with other creatures, can also be distinctive. For instance, ghost crabs are known for their habit of digging deep burrows in the sand and scurrying across the beach at lightning speed. These crabs are well-adapted to life in the harsh environment of the sandy shoreline, and their behavior reflects their adaptations. Hermit crabs, on the other hand, are known for their habit of living in empty snail shells. These crabs do not have their own shells, so they must find and occupy a discarded snail shell for protection. Hermit crabs are often seen scuttling across the seafloor with their adopted shells, and their behavior is a clear indication of their unique lifestyle. The feeding habits of crabs can also be informative. Some crabs are scavengers, feeding on dead animals and other organic matter. Others are predators, actively hunting for prey. Some crabs are filter feeders, using specialized appendages to strain plankton and other microorganisms from the water. The diet of a crab can influence its behavior and its overall appearance. Crabs that feed on hard-shelled prey, such as shellfish, often have powerful claws that are adapted for crushing and tearing. Crabs that feed on soft-bodied prey may have more delicate claws that are adapted for grasping and manipulating. The social behavior of crabs can also be a helpful clue. Some crabs are solitary creatures, while others live in groups or colonies. Some crabs are territorial, defending their burrows or feeding grounds from other crabs. 1. Dungeness Crab
The Dungeness crab (Metacarcinus magister) is a popular West Coast crab known for its delicious meat. They have a broad, oval carapace and can grow up to 10 inches wide. Look for their distinctive purple-tinged claws. They are commonly found in bays and estuaries, and they are a prized catch for both commercial and recreational fishermen. The Dungeness crab gets its name from Dungeness, Washington, a town located on the Olympic Peninsula where the crab was first commercially harvested. These crabs are an important part of the marine ecosystem, and they play a role in controlling populations of other invertebrates. They are also a popular food source for larger predators, such as sea otters and seals. The Dungeness crab is a slow-growing species, and it can take several years for them to reach maturity. This makes them vulnerable to overfishing, so it is important to manage their populations sustainably. Regulations are in place to protect Dungeness crab populations, such as size limits, catch limits, and seasonal closures. These regulations help to ensure that Dungeness crabs remain a healthy and abundant resource for future generations.
2. Blue Crab
The blue crab (Callinectes sapidus) is another popular species, found along the Atlantic and Gulf Coasts of North America. They have a spiny carapace and bright blue claws (in males). They are aggressive predators and scavengers, and they are known for their delicious meat. The blue crab is a highly adaptable species, and it can tolerate a wide range of salinities and temperatures. This allows them to thrive in a variety of habitats, from brackish estuaries to saltwater bays. Blue crabs are important predators in the estuarine ecosystem, and they help to control populations of other invertebrates. They are also an important food source for larger predators, such as fish and birds. Blue crabs are also an important economic resource, and they are harvested commercially and recreationally. Overfishing and habitat loss can threaten blue crab populations, so it is important to manage their populations sustainably. Regulations are in place to protect blue crab populations, such as size limits, catch limits, and seasonal closures. These regulations help to ensure that blue crabs remain a healthy and abundant resource for future generations.
3. Fiddler Crab
Fiddler crabs (Uca spp.) are easy to spot thanks to the male's one enormous claw, which they wave around like a fiddle. They live in intertidal mudflats and salt marshes. These crabs are highly social animals, and they live in colonies that can number in the hundreds or even thousands of individuals. Fiddler crabs are known for their distinctive mating rituals, in which males wave their large claws to attract females. The size of the male's claw is an indication of his fitness, and females are more likely to mate with males that have larger claws. Fiddler crabs are important scavengers in the intertidal ecosystem, and they help to break down organic matter. They also provide a food source for other animals, such as birds and fish. Fiddler crabs are sensitive to pollution and habitat destruction, so they are often used as indicators of environmental health. The presence of healthy fiddler crab populations is a sign that an ecosystem is thriving, while the absence of fiddler crabs can indicate that there are problems.
4. Hermit Crab
Hermit crabs are the unique crabs that live in discarded shells. They're not born with their own shells, so they find empty ones (usually snail shells) to call home. As they grow, they need to find larger shells. You can find them in a variety of habitats, from beaches to tide pools. Hermit crabs are fascinating creatures, and they play an important role in the marine ecosystem. They are scavengers, feeding on dead animals and other organic matter. They also provide a food source for other animals, such as fish and birds. Hermit crabs are popular pets, but it is important to provide them with a suitable habitat and diet. They need a tank with plenty of substrate for digging, as well as a variety of empty shells that they can move into as they grow. They also need a balanced diet of fruits, vegetables, and protein.
Tips for Ethical Crab Watching
Okay, now that you're a crab identification whiz, let's talk about being a responsible crab observer. These creatures are part of a delicate ecosystem, and it's important to treat them with respect. We want to watch and learn without causing harm, right? Ethical crab watching is all about observing crabs in their natural habitat without disturbing them or their environment. It's about appreciating these fascinating creatures while ensuring their well-being and the health of their ecosystem. One of the most important things you can do is to avoid handling crabs. Crabs are sensitive creatures, and handling them can cause them stress or even injury. Their shells are not designed to be handled by human hands, and the oils and chemicals on our skin can be harmful to them. If you do need to handle a crab for some reason, such as to move it out of harm's way, be sure to wet your hands first and handle it gently. Another important tip is to avoid disturbing their habitat. Crabs live in a variety of habitats, from sandy beaches to rocky tide pools, and they rely on these habitats for food, shelter, and reproduction. When you are exploring crab habitats, be careful not to step on or crush any vegetation or disturb the rocks or sand. This can damage the habitat and make it difficult for crabs to survive. It is also important to avoid littering in crab habitats. Trash can pollute the water and harm marine life, including crabs. Be sure to pack out all of your trash and dispose of it properly. If you see any trash on the beach or in the water, consider picking it up and disposing of it yourself. This will help to keep crab habitats clean and healthy. Finally, be respectful of other crab watchers. Everyone should have the opportunity to observe crabs in their natural habitat without being disturbed. Keep your distance from other observers and avoid making loud noises or sudden movements that could scare the crabs away.
